Output d357aab9c160b41f787642d3c2cb35d82b94c35542a7d3f821b6753a1a30dd11:5

value
30358460
script pubkey
OP_0 OP_PUSHBYTES_20 76fe9f3f70cfe42cbeb8ae75ebc3f4aed8e2e8cb
address
ltc1qwmlf70mseljze04c4e67hsl54mvw96xtulzsn4
transaction
d357aab9c160b41f787642d3c2cb35d82b94c35542a7d3f821b6753a1a30dd11
spent
true